Characteristics and Geochronology of the W, Mo-Bearing Granodiorite Porphyry in Dongyuan, Southern Anhui Province

Based on the field investigation, profiling and geochemical testing in detail, the systematic studies have been performed on geochronology of the Dongyuan W, Mo-bearing granodiorite porphyry in southern Anhui Province. The Sensitive High Resolution Ion Micro Probe (SHRIMP) U-Pb zircon dating yields a concordant age of (146 ±1) Ma for granodiorite, suggesting that the intrusive body was formed during Late Jurassic. While the Re-Os dating result of 146 Ma shows that the molybdenite from the body was formed in the Late Jurassic, the same stage when the intrusive body formed. The content of Re from the molybdenite (22.02×10-6~98.09×10-6) shows that the ore-forming materials are derived from the crust-mantle mixed source.
